GUIDE · No 01
PLA
Polylactic Acid
★ BEST FOR BEGINNERS + DISPLAY PARTS
Stiff, easy to print, eco-friendly-ish. The default for prototypes, cosplay, and anything that doesn't need to survive heat.
GUIDE · No 02
PETG
Glycol-modified PET
★ FUNCTIONAL PARTS DONE RIGHT
Tougher than PLA, water and chemical resistant, food-safe grades available. Our default for real-world parts.
GUIDE · No 03
ABS
Acrylonitrile Butadiene Styrene
★ HEAT + IMPACT RESISTANCE
The Lego plastic. Heat-tolerant, paintable, post-machinable. For parts that live under the hood or in the sun.
GUIDE · No 04
TPU
Thermoplastic Polyurethane
★ FLEXIBLE + ABRASION RESISTANT
The rubbery one. Shore 95A. Gaskets, grips, vibration dampers — parts that need to squish and bounce back.
GUIDE · No 05
PETG–HF
High-Flow PETG
★ SAME STRENGTH · 3× FASTER
Bambu Lab's reformulated PETG for high-speed printing. Same properties, fraction of the print time.
GUIDE · No 06
PAHT–CF
Carbon-Fiber Polyamide
★ NEAR-METAL STIFFNESS · EXOTIC
Carbon-fiber-reinforced nylon. Stronger, stiffer, and dimensionally stable. For parts that need to punch above their weight.
